Toledo to serve as Tigers alternate training location

Players will report to Toledo following spring training
June 24, 2020

The Detroit Tigers announced that the team’s alternate training location for the upcoming season will be in Toledo. “We’ve had a longstanding relationship with the Tigers and their leadership team, and have been discussing this arrangement for several weeks,” said Joe Napoli, Toledo Mud Hens President and CEO. “Toledo is very excited to assist the Tigers and host team personnel as Major League Baseball (MLB) returns to play.”

Detroit Tigers Executive Vice President of Baseball Operations and General Manager Al Avila: “Toledo’s proximity to Detroit and our 30-plus year affiliation made it a natural choice to serve as our alternate training location, and we’re glad it came together. We appreciate the Mud Hens’ organization for their partnership during this unique 2020 season.”

“As plans become finalized and the players arrive in Toledo, we hope fans will be able to watch the workouts and intrasquad scrimmages,” said Toledo Mud Hens General Manager, Erik Ibsen. “We will share those plans as soon as they become finalized. We are working with ProMedica, the Toledo-Lucas County Health Department and the State of Ohio to implement the necessary safety protocols set forth by the Governor’s office.”

The Tigers spring training began on July 1 and Opening Day is slated for Friday, July 24. The arrival of players in Toledo is expected to be in conjunction with the beginning of the Major League season.


UPDATE (7/21): Fifth Third Field in Toledo will serve as Detroit’s alternate training location for the 2020 season. Eight of the Tigers top 10 prospects according to MLB Pipeline will begin the season at the alternate site. Those players include RHP’s Casey Mize (No. 1 prospect), Matt Manning (No. 2) and Alex Faedo (No. 9), LHP Tarik Skubal (No. 4), C Jake Rogers (No. 10), INF Isaac Paredes (No. 5) and OF’s Riley Greene (No. 3) and Daz Cameron (No. 7). Additionally, 3B Spencer Torkelson, the No. 1 overall pick in the 2020 MLB Draft, will start the season at the alternate location. Coaches, trainers and support staff from Detroit’s player development system will oversee the workouts.
